1939d4bc6fcbdc9847fd6103e0687a7f788c67dd: Bug 1365293 - Enable e10s tests on linux64-ccov. r=jmaher
Greg Mierzwinski <gmierz2@outlook.com> - Mon, 22 May 2017 07:37:30 -0400 - rev 360144
Push 31871 by ryanvm@gmail.com at Tue, 23 May 2017 22:02:07 +0000
Bug 1365293 - Enable e10s tests on linux64-ccov. r=jmaher MozReview-Commit-ID: 74yq4yzqXJ7
b8e521edbe831c5245d0d69dbc22cfeeab608fb5: Bug 1353042 - Get rid of all sdk/tabs and sdk/tabs/utils usage; r=zer0
Patrick Brosset <pbrosset@mozilla.com> - Tue, 02 May 2017 16:46:54 +0200 - rev 360143
Push 31871 by ryanvm@gmail.com at Tue, 23 May 2017 22:02:07 +0000
Bug 1353042 - Get rid of all sdk/tabs and sdk/tabs/utils usage; r=zer0 Removed obsolete browser_dbg_event-listeners-03/4.js tests (they are for the old debugger, and the new debugger doesn't even support event listeners yet, so no use keeping this test around). Removed getBrowserForTab SDK dependency from command-state.js. Changed the implementation of addTab/removeTab in perf test's tab-utils helper. MozReview-Commit-ID: 7EXJ5K3kaJm
31a809d5ca1a73f1d903d4b15f528094e0533b2a: Bug 1364068 - Enable the 'new-profile' ping. r=gfritzsche
Alessio Placitelli <alessio.placitelli@gmail.com> - Mon, 22 May 2017 12:52:19 +0200 - rev 360142
Push 31871 by ryanvm@gmail.com at Tue, 23 May 2017 22:02:07 +0000
Bug 1364068 - Enable the 'new-profile' ping. r=gfritzsche MozReview-Commit-ID: 6DXa20aCOBr
1ce55499e8193d53aeff91546b16e0c580ebd6f1: Backed out 2 changesets (bug 1359965) for likely breaking tc nightlies a=backout
Wes Kocher <wkocher@mozilla.com> - Tue, 23 May 2017 12:55:35 -0700 - rev 360141
Push 31870 by kwierso@gmail.com at Tue, 23 May 2017 19:55:43 +0000
Backed out 2 changesets (bug 1359965) for likely breaking tc nightlies a=backout Backed out changeset a0e257e346cc (bug 1359965) Backed out changeset ae8bce278626 (bug 1359965) MozReview-Commit-ID: 9rGpv7CFofi
6dfa56094f0cc291945dd3c24d0a4c2682d80ec7: No bug, Automated HPKP preload list update from host bld-linux64-spot-305 - a=hpkp-update
ffxbld - Tue, 23 May 2017 08:08:00 -0700 - rev 360140
Push 31869 by ffxbld at Tue, 23 May 2017 15:08:04 +0000
No bug, Automated HPKP preload list update from host bld-linux64-spot-305 - a=hpkp-update
bc50d1ecef33e32ef76d155311d3d14410466dff: No bug, Automated HSTS preload list update from host bld-linux64-spot-305 - a=hsts-update
ffxbld - Tue, 23 May 2017 08:07:57 -0700 - rev 360139
Push 31869 by ffxbld at Tue, 23 May 2017 15:08:04 +0000
No bug, Automated HSTS preload list update from host bld-linux64-spot-305 - a=hsts-update
3a82a745123f1f0f36937a45b877724023d112cd: Merge autoland to m-c. a=merge
Ryan VanderMeulen <ryanvm@gmail.com> - Tue, 23 May 2017 10:32:42 -0400 - rev 360138
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Merge autoland to m-c. a=merge
39cc9ca51737db91aab30d8c47b778c0cbd5591e: Bug 1366707 - update callers of cubeb_device_collection_destroy. r=kinetik
Alex Chronopoulos <achronop@gmail.com> - Tue, 23 May 2017 11:30:05 +0300 - rev 360137
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1366707 - update callers of cubeb_device_collection_destroy. r=kinetik MozReview-Commit-ID: JByi6XfgWh2
9024a001f962c786f27f51a4554f7c6c8b2c6b29: Bug 1366707 - Update cubeb from upstream to 96cdb17. r=kinetik
Alex Chronopoulos <achronop@gmail.com> - Tue, 23 May 2017 11:29:33 +0300 - rev 360136
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1366707 - Update cubeb from upstream to 96cdb17. r=kinetik MozReview-Commit-ID: 3aiEtrl289U
1f499580389b241af7736135f249dbe2a830066a: Backed out changeset 4c2036f901c1 (bug 1353042) for build bustage in Symlink target path does not exist: doc_event-listeners-04.html
Iris Hsiao <ihsiao@mozilla.com> - Tue, 23 May 2017 16:15:23 +0800 - rev 360135
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Backed out changeset 4c2036f901c1 (bug 1353042) for build bustage in Symlink target path does not exist: doc_event-listeners-04.html CLOSED TREE
1507721df493580f035695ad088890b5cbb78ba6: Bug 1363968 - Change how counter-{reset,increment} is parsed to align serialization of specified value with Servo and Blink. r=heycam
Xidorn Quan <me@upsuper.org> - Tue, 23 May 2017 13:28:47 +1000 - rev 360134
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1363968 - Change how counter-{reset,increment} is parsed to align serialization of specified value with Servo and Blink. r=heycam This also includes a small fix to manifest of the affected mochitest. MozReview-Commit-ID: 1b8lba5JiHr
0300ea496f8b957061804a61662db34479aec6e9: Bug 1364991 - Make U2FTokenManager use const where possible r=qdot
Axel Nennker <ignisvulpis@gmail.com> - Mon, 22 May 2017 16:40:29 -0700 - rev 360133
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1364991 - Make U2FTokenManager use const where possible r=qdot The U2F Soft Token, due to its usage of NSS, has to have const values be marked non-const - but no such limitation should exist for other implementations of U2F, so this patch moves the const_cast-ing from the U2FTokenManager-level down to the U2FSoftTokenManager, where it is actually necessary. Credit to Axel Nennker for this patch. MozReview-Commit-ID: Kw6zfTDI3GL
8649b10a34c18f0e6c57106748750e0a67009d42: Bug 1348522 - Remove unused files from chrome://global/skin/media/ r=florian
Dan Banner <dbugs@thebanners.uk> - Sun, 14 May 2017 19:14:59 +0100 - rev 360132
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1348522 - Remove unused files from chrome://global/skin/media/ r=florian MozReview-Commit-ID: wE6BIj9x0n
4c2036f901c1dab4774958fbe51a62737b324923: Bug 1353042 - Get rid of all sdk/tabs and sdk/tabs/utils usage; r=zer0
Patrick Brosset <pbrosset@mozilla.com> - Tue, 02 May 2017 16:46:54 +0200 - rev 360131
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1353042 - Get rid of all sdk/tabs and sdk/tabs/utils usage; r=zer0 Removed obsolete browser_dbg_event-listeners-03/4.js tests (they are for the old debugger, and the new debugger doesn't even support event listeners yet, so no use keeping this test around). Removed getBrowserForTab SDK dependency from command-state.js. Changed the implementation of addTab/removeTab in perf test's tab-utils helper. MozReview-Commit-ID: 7EXJ5K3kaJm
8818d31a2a397ff86a4b843e11ed0ba31c4c8f3e: servo: Merge #16979 - remove unused style::restyle_hints::RestyleReplacements (from manfredbrandl:patch-1); r=emilio
Manfred Brandl <manfred@brandl.net> - Tue, 23 May 2017 00:31:15 -0500 - rev 360130
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
servo: Merge #16979 - remove unused style::restyle_hints::RestyleReplacements (from manfredbrandl:patch-1); r=emilio <!-- Please describe your changes on the following line: --> remove unused style::restyle_hints::RestyleReplacements from line 134 --- <!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: --> - [X] `./mach build -d` does not report any errors - [X] `./mach test-tidy` does not report any errors - [X] These changes fix #16978 (github issue number if applicable). <!-- Either: --> - [X] These changes do not require tests because removes only unused "use" <!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.--> <!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. --> Source-Repo: https://github.com/servo/servo Source-Revision: e8f9ab51cacf75d5d92c2b87a9c23eea5bd0aed3
9bc41c3089925e4ef042af81b59a6269083100c5: Bug 1366639 - Add telemetry to track max number of PChromiumCDM video frame shmems. r=francois,gerald
Chris Pearce <cpearce@mozilla.com> - Mon, 22 May 2017 15:03:00 +1200 - rev 360129
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1366639 - Add telemetry to track max number of PChromiumCDM video frame shmems. r=francois,gerald This will enable us to pre-allocate the correct number of shared memory buffers that we pre-allocate for sending video frames between the CDM and Gecko. That means we won't need to take the slow path to recover from underestimating how many shmems we need. MozReview-Commit-ID: Q4mX2rYMz3
09de5eeb4d2d3d3237982ff533c73dc72a53a43e: No bug - Revendor rust dependencies
Servo VCS Sync <servo-vcs-sync@mozilla.com> - Tue, 23 May 2017 05:17:49 +0000 - rev 360128
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
No bug - Revendor rust dependencies
80aba64b0c6bf509b2a0ec499ce12f935157d7c9: servo: Merge #16779 - [gfx] [layout] [style] Upgrade unicode-bidi to 0.3 (from behnam:bidi-0.3); r=mbrubeck
Behnam Esfahbod <behnam@zwnj.org> - Mon, 22 May 2017 23:06:07 -0500 - rev 360127
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
servo: Merge #16779 - [gfx] [layout] [style] Upgrade unicode-bidi to 0.3 (from behnam:bidi-0.3); r=mbrubeck Depends on https://github.com/servo/unicode-bidi/pull/27 , which upgrades `unicode-bidi` crate to `0.3.0`. Summary of changes: * Use `unicode_bidi::Level` (instead of `u8`) in all relevant places and replace magic computations with (inline) method calls to Level API. * Doing so required adding `unicode-bidi` crate dependency to two more components here: `style` and `gfx`. IMHO, totally makes sense, as replaces local integer manipulations/checks with well-tested ones already available in a common dependency. --- <!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: --> - [X] `./mach build -d` does not report any errors - [X] `./mach test-tidy` does not report any errors - [ ] These changes fix #__ (github issue number if applicable). [N/A] <!-- Either: --> - [ ] There are tests for these changes OR - [X] These changes do not require tests because `unicode-bidi` has its own tests and there's no logic change in this diff. <!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.--> <!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. --> Source-Repo: https://github.com/servo/servo Source-Revision: edd6c2cecb2c245f9f8bcab04ff8e57f1c5d1333
15c96c8b05cc08498d2b6fbad03ea3dd230c580e: Bug 1328507 - Enable mochitests disabled because of this bug. r=xidorn
Xidorn Quan <me@upsuper.org> - Tue, 23 May 2017 14:51:21 +1000 - rev 360126
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
Bug 1328507 - Enable mochitests disabled because of this bug. r=xidorn MozReview-Commit-ID: EA27tfe33JQ
621439cb44b1bcc9cc8415ee076deee48ef8431c: servo: Merge #16968 - Stylist accessors (from HeyZoos:stylist-accessors); r=emilio
heyzoos <jbracho@uchicago.edu> - Mon, 22 May 2017 20:12:46 -0500 - rev 360125
Push 31868 by ryanvm@gmail.com at Tue, 23 May 2017 14:32:52 +0000
servo: Merge #16968 - Stylist accessors (from HeyZoos:stylist-accessors); r=emilio <!-- Please describe your changes on the following line: --> Add accessor methods for the `device` and `ruleset` fields in the `Stylist` struct. --- <!-- Thank you for contributing to Servo! Please replace each `[ ]` by `[X]` when the step is complete, and replace `__` with appropriate data: --> - [X] `./mach build -d` does not report any errors - [X] `./mach test-tidy` does not report any errors - [X] These changes fix #16857 (github issue number if applicable). <!-- Either: --> - [X] There are tests for these changes <!-- Also, please make sure that "Allow edits from maintainers" checkbox is checked, so that we can help you if you get stuck somewhere along the way.--> <!-- Pull requests that do not address these steps are welcome, but they will require additional verification as part of the review process. --> Source-Repo: https://github.com/servo/servo Source-Revision: 1306b16d5a170074b4f42046a7b1a3a43952b346
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 +30000 +100000 tip